## Deploying the Gatewick Proctor Queue

Deploys are pretty painless: push to main, wait for the pipeline, then watch the queue drain dashboard for five minutes. If candidates pile up mid-exam, roll back first and ask questions later — the queue replays safely. Everything the workers care about lives in one config block, shown here for reference.

settings of bafof-yagef:
JOROX_PIN=8740
JOROX_TENANT=pelox
JOROX_METRICS_HOST=metrics.jorox.qorvelworks.internal
JOROX_SEAL=seal_c78f63c1
JOROX_STANDBY_TEAM=norax

Quarterly Planning Note — Retail Pilot. Quick update for the board: the pilot with the Dorrel & Finch chain kicks off next month across six stores in the Calbright area. We're stocking the Lumenbay shelf units and tracking sell-through weekly. Early signs from staff training sessions are encouraging, and Dorrel's buyers seem keen. If numbers hold, we'll push for a regional rollout. The thinking behind this is noted just below.

management briefing: The southern region missed its Oliox quota by 51.7 percent last quarter. Juldorek Freight plans to raise the Silath list price by 49.7 percent in January. The board signed off on a budget of $388.0 million for Project Casok. The renewal with Fradorix Foods closes at $53.0 million a year, 49.8 percent below the last contract.

## Limits & Quotas — Carlane Occupancy Feed

This page covers the operational limits for the Carlane garage occupancy feed. On-call engineers should know that upstream sensors are rate-limited per gate, and the aggregator drops batches that exceed the payload ceiling rather than splitting them. Consumers polling faster than the allowed interval receive cached counts, which can look like a stuck feed. Before paging the sensor vendor team, verify the current limits, which are defined as follows.

tuning table, yajog-yahof:
BUDGETS = {
    "lamvan": 303,
    "wenox": 460,
    "fenvan": 525,
}